A decision was made to replace everything in the coolant system, one item at a time, in an effort to eliminate the leaks and the odor. The truck has a heater control valve in the water lines. This control valve has four hose connections. Two of the hoses were fastened to the valve with spring clamps. While removing these two hoses, the valve actually broke into pieces. The barbed hose fittings cracked through and broke off!
Perhaps those spring clamps hold on too tightly. Perhaps the cracks, hence the leaks, were a result of those spring clamps. The hand in the picture is holding one of those spring clamps, and two of the four hose barbs are seen to have completely broken away from the valve. The valve would have broken apart sometime this summer on a hot, hot day.
